Curve 7605q5

7605 = 32 · 5 · 132



Data for elliptic curve 7605q5

Field Data Notes
Atkin-Lehner 3- 5- 13+ Signs for the Atkin-Lehner involutions
Class 7605q Isogeny class
Conductor 7605 Conductor
∏ cp 32 Product of Tamagawa factors cp
Δ 577161945398025 = 314 · 52 · 136 Discriminant
Eigenvalues -1 3- 5-  0 -4 13+ -2 -4 Hecke eigenvalues for primes up to 20
Equation [1,-1,1,-205367,35854134] [a1,a2,a3,a4,a6]
Generators [309:1197:1] Generators of the group modulo torsion
j 272223782641/164025 j-invariant
L 2.5920412169462 L(r)(E,1)/r!
Ω 0.51120664011138 Real period
R 2.5352186508976 Regulator
r 1 Rank of the group of rational points
S 1 (Analytic) order of Ш
t 4 Number of elements in the torsion subgroup
Twists 121680en6 2535a5 38025bc6 45a5 Quadratic twists by: -4 -3 5 13
